Year: 1990
Runtime: 163 mins
Language: Hindi
Director: Rajkumar Santoshi
Ajay Mehra trains in Bombay as an international boxer, returns to New Delhi to find his brother Ashok missing, but police dismiss his complaints. When Ashok’s body is found, Ajay is framed for murder and an affair with sister‑in‑law Indu. In jail he befriends convicts, escapes, and with Varsha’s help reveals culprit, Balwant Rai, clearing his name.
